Criando um Ticker em dispositivos J2ME

Veja nesta dica o que é, e como implementar um Ticker.

Criando um Ticker em dispositivos J2ME

 

O Ticker é um texto que se movimenta continuamente na tela. Veja abaixo um pequeno exemplo.

 

<B><SPAN lang=EN-US >import </SPAN></B><SPAN lang=EN-US >javax.microedition.lcdui.*;</SPAN>
<B><SPAN lang=EN-US >import </SPAN></B><SPAN lang=EN-US >javax.microedition.midlet.MIDlet;</SPAN>

<B><SPAN lang=EN-US >public class </SPAN></B><SPAN lang=EN-US >TickerDemo </SPAN><B><SPAN lang=EN-US >extends </SPAN></B><SPAN lang=EN-US >MIDlet {</SPAN>
<SPAN lang=EN-US >String str = </SPAN><SPAN lang=EN-US >"Oi, tudo bom?"</SPAN><SPAN lang=EN-US >;</SPAN>
<SPAN lang=EN-US >Form form;</SPAN>

<B><SPAN lang=EN-US >public </SPAN></B><SPAN lang=EN-US >TickerDemo() {</SPAN>
<SPAN lang=EN-US >form = </SPAN><B><SPAN lang=EN-US >new </SPAN></B><SPAN lang=EN-US >Form(</SPAN><SPAN lang=EN-US >"Ticker"</SPAN><SPAN lang=EN-US >);</SPAN>
<SPAN lang=EN-US >}</SPAN>

<B><SPAN lang=EN-US >protected void </SPAN></B><SPAN lang=EN-US >startApp() {</SPAN>
<SPAN lang=EN-US >Ticker t = </SPAN><B><SPAN lang=EN-US >new </SPAN></B><SPAN lang=EN-US >Ticker(str);</SPAN>
<SPAN lang=EN-US >form.setTicker(t);</SPAN>
<SPAN lang=EN-US >Display.getDisplay(</SPAN><B><SPAN lang=EN-US >this</SPAN></B><SPAN lang=EN-US >).setCurrent(form);</SPAN>
<SPAN lang=EN-US >}</SPAN>

<B><SPAN lang=EN-US >protected void </SPAN></B><SPAN lang=EN-US >destroyApp(</SPAN><B><SPAN lang=EN-US >boolean </SPAN></B><SPAN lang=EN-US >unconditional) {}</SPAN>

<B><SPAN lang=EN-US >protected void </SPAN></B><SPAN lang=EN-US >pauseApp() {}</SPAN>
<SPAN lang=EN-US >}</SPAN>

Artigos relacionados